Essential Safety Criteria for Pool Ladders

When evaluating a ladder, start by looking at the weight capacity and the material’s durability against UV rays. A ladder that flexes under pressure is a recipe for a slip, so prioritize high-density polyethylene or reinforced resin structures. These materials withstand the harsh combination of pool chemicals and direct sunlight without becoming brittle over time.

Beyond materials, consider the "footprint" and the anti-slip texture of the treads. You want wide, textured steps that provide full-foot support rather than narrow rungs that can catch a toe or cause a loss of balance. If you have young children or elderly swimmers, choosing a model with handrails that extend well above the pool deck is non-negotiable.

Proper Ladder Installation and Maintenance

Installation is where most safety issues begin, so always ensure your ladder is perfectly level and securely anchored to the pool deck or top rail. Even the best ladder will wobble if it’s poorly installed. Use high-quality stainless steel hardware to prevent rust, and check the tension of all bolts at the start of every swimming season.

Maintenance is just as important as the initial setup. Periodically inspect the steps for cracks or signs of wear, and clean them with a mild, non-abrasive cleaner to remove algae buildup, which can make the surface dangerously slick. A clean ladder is a safe ladder, so don’t neglect this simple chore.

Seasonal Safety Tips for Pool Access

As the seasons change, your approach to pool safety should evolve as well. Before opening the pool in the spring, perform a thorough inspection of the ladder’s structural integrity after the winter freeze. If you notice any fading or brittleness in the plastic, it is time to replace the unit to avoid a mid-season failure.

When closing the pool for the winter, remove the ladder entirely if possible to protect it from harsh weather and ice damage. If you must leave it in, ensure it is properly winterized and secured so that it doesn’t become a hazard during the off-season. Being proactive about your gear ensures that your pool remains a place of joy rather than a source of worry.
